We are seeking a results driven operationally experienced eComm and merchandise lead to manage the planning & execution of global merchandise campaigns across D2C and other channels.

The role will be cross functional leading across our frontline label CFT managing the delivery of all eCommerce campaign functions including store design / build launch and merchandise production and operational execution.

You will lead and coach a team of 3 leads and be the lead relationship manager with UK Direct To Fan / Commerce Directors and US label CFT leads. You will work across the Direct to Fan organization with store management operations product development and music / merch supply chain teams retail & licensing and international commerce teams.

The role will be pivotal in helping to support the growth of UK & international artists merchandise revenue with the following responsibilities.

Lead the team and inform

  • Lead and coach the eCommerce campaign management team overseeing the planning launch and execution of international merchandise campaigns in-line with D2C campaign strategy best practice.
  • Management of merchandise P&L and revenue forecasting.
  • Work across Account / Brand Mgmt N1C and Product Development & Supply Chain teams to co-ordinate the development of artist merch ranges.
  • Manage a team of leads embedded in label cross functional teams.
  • Drive adherence of launch timelines checklists templates and best practice and implement core KPIs to ensure successful international launches.
  • Build label relationships report sales trends & operational metrics serve as escalation point for the team and identify campaign pitfalls whilst sharing learnings to inform future campaigns.
  • Navigate internal and external politics with tact while protecting realistic delivery plans and operational integrity.
  • Oversee Campaign Management and ownership of key milestones across the full lifecycle including planning product and merch development content and asset readiness launch and ongoing performance and inventory management.
  • Foster a culture of high performance innovation collaboration for team members.

Work with key stakeholders

  • Work with label & US CFT leads US to implement profitable product P&Ls ensuring pricing and is approved for international releases prior to launch.
  • Work across CRM & Paid Marketing CFT team leads teams to develop integrated product/marketing campaigns for artists.
  • Work closely with Sales Licensing and Touring departments to develop product lines and ensure the artist strategy is executed.
  • Work with e-Commerce Ops and Fan Experience teams to resolve issues on inbound and outbound supply chain optimize fulfilment and measure the customer feedback loop ensuring customer satisfaction.

Think strategically and create scalable playbooks and strategies

  • Develop campaign strategies across the merchandise channel to drive revenue engagement and acquisition and hit label goals.
  • Manage local retail activations eg pop up and experiential retail with all relevant teams (retail / production / ops).
  • Design and map all process flows for international inbound campaigns develop RACI charts documentation and oversee process mapping to drive efficiency.
  • Drive process adoption of campaign planning tools and milestone management across the group.
  • Develop processes to deliver engaging ecommerce experiences driving revenue and chart performance and a great customer experience for fans.
  • Design refine and scale workflows and playbooks for Campaign Management grounded in your understanding of the channel-specific requirements.
  • Continuously iterate and improve processes based on team feedback and business trends to increase speed and quality of campaign launches.
  • Partner with Operations Technology and Data teams to ensure tools systems and dashboards support efficient planning and execution.

Implement KPIs and improvements

  • Conduct regular performance reviews with label teams and senior stakeholders and oversee project delivery ensuring timelines milestones.
  • Foster a culture of high performance continuous learning creativity and open knowledge sharing.
  • Find new ways to streamline processes & lean on tools/automation to allow us to work smarter and in a more efficient way.
